## Onboarding: Farebranch Rules Engine

Plugin authors integrate with Farebranch by registering fee rules against the evaluation API. Rules are sandboxed; they cannot perform network calls directly. All rate-table lookups go through the host, which validates your plugin manifest at load time. Your local env file must include the signing credential the host uses to verify manifests, set on the next line.

secret setting of bajef-fajof: COURIER_KEY3=76c

Action item (PM-142): The Quartzdb planner regression caused full scans on joined lookups after the 9.4 rollout. Fix shipped; hints removed. Support: if customers report slow dashboard loads, check plan output before escalating. Escalate only if seq scans persist post-upgrade. Steps for pulling a customer's query plan are documented on the internal triage page.

operations page: https://jenkins.zemvarcloud.local/job/merge_requests/repo/build/73930b4b30f0a8ed

Welcome to the Gridmire review rotation. The crossword generator in Puzzlewick builds grids via backtracking over the Thornely word list, scoring fill quality before committing each slot. Review changes for symmetry preservation and dictionary licensing flags. Tests live under the solver suite and must pass deterministically with the fixed seed. To regenerate the sealed test fixtures locally, the tooling will request the recovery passphrase, which follows below.

strongbox words: norwyn-wenael-aldvan-aldiel-wendor-holael

☐ Intern cohort arrival — night shift prep

The Glimmerpath summer interns (about a dozen of them) land at Carden House first thing Monday, so set things up before you clock off. Stack the welcome folders by the turnstiles, prop open meeting room B, and leave the lanyard box with whoever's on the morning desk. They can't badge in yet, so tape a note to the side gate with the visitor code below.

turnstile pass: bdg-JVSWH-52711

Runbook: Localizing date formats

Hey, welcome aboard. When a locale complains about weird dates in Driftnote, it's almost always the formatter config, not the data. Check locale-overrides.yml first — each region has its own pattern entry. Never hardcode formats in templates; the linter will catch you anyway. Test with the Kestrel locale pack, then confirm against the build listed below.

build token for yajof-bajof: htk31_506ff1188f74596b5bb2eec94edc43c